Job Purpose

To support the delivery of outstanding, person-centred care by ensuring clients receive high-quality support that promotes independence, dignity, and wellbeing. The Field Care Supervisor will work closely with clients, families, Care Professionals, and office staff to maintain service quality, compliance, and excellent client outcomes.ย 

Key Responsibilities

Client Care & Quality Assurance

  • Support care consultations, assessments, and service reviews.
  • Complete and update person-centred care plans and risk assessments.
  • Carry out quality assurance visits and spot checks.
  • Monitor client satisfaction and identify opportunities to improve service delivery.
  • Conduct client introductions and ensure smooth transitions when new Care Professionals are introduced.
  • Maintain strong relationships with clients, their families, health professionals, and community partners.
  • Respond appropriately to safeguarding concerns, incidents, and complaints.

Care Professional Support

  • Conduct regular supervisions, observations, competency assessments, and support visits.
  • Mentor and support Care Professionals to achieve excellent standards of care.
  • Identify training and development needs and work with the Trainer and Care Manager to address them.
  • Promote employee engagement, wellbeing, and retention.
  • Support new Care Professional inductions and probation reviews.

Compliance & Documentation

  • Create, update, and audit care records to ensure they remain accurate and compliant.
  • Maintain records using Home Instead systems, including Birdie and People Planner.
  • Ensure medication administration records are completed correctly and concerns are escalated promptly.
  • Support the office in achieving and maintaining CQC compliance standards.
  • Assist with audits and quality improvement initiatives.

Operational Support

  • Maintain regular contact with clients and Care Professionals.
  • Support the scheduling and client experience teams when required.
  • Participate in the on-call rota.
  • Assist with care delivery during emergencies or staffing shortages when appropriate.
  • Support the development and growth of the service through excellent customer care and relationship building.
